About

Peggy Ratliff is a licensed professional counselor (LPC) practicing in Arkansas with seven years of clinical experience. She works with adults facing stress, anxiety, trauma and abuse, grief, depression, and difficulties coping with life changes. Her background also includes attention to relationship concerns, adult ADHD, and a range of related challenges such as abandonment issues, attachment difficulties, caregiver stress, and chronic illness or pain.

Ratliff approaches each person as the expert of their own story, recognizing individual strengths as central resources for change. She emphasizes collaboration, helping people identify practical steps and personal strengths to move toward goals that matter to them. Her work includes support for those navigating divorce or separation, body image and commitment issues, codependency, and the emotional impacts of serious illness.

Clients who choose Ratliff can expect a supportive professional relationship that highlights empowerment and steady progress. She acknowledges the courage it takes to seek change and aims to be a consistent ally in the process of coping, adapting, and building a more satisfying life.
